Deel: Best for Speed and Contractor Management

Deel quickly stands out for its fast onboarding and easy-to-use platform. Its tech-first approach automates global hiring. This helps companies create compliant contracts and set up payroll in just minutes.

Deel is unique. It merges EOR for full-time employees with a solid method to manage and pay international contractors. You can do all this from one dashboard. This makes it an excellent choice for businesses that rely on a hybrid workforce of both permanent staff and freelancers. Deel offers flexible pricing and broad global coverage. This makes it a great choice for companies that value speed and efficiency in hiring and payments.

Remote: Best for Compliance and Owned Infrastructure

Remote stands out because it focuses on legal and HR compliance. It operates its own legal entities in the countries it serves. Our direct infrastructure model sets us apart from competitors who rely on third-party partners.

It gives businesses better security. It also offers stronger protection for intellectual property. Plus, there’s more control over hiring. Remote provides strong benefits administration. This ensures that employee packages are competitive and meet local regulations.

Remote’s focus on owning the entire service delivery stack makes it ideal for risk-averse companies. This is especially true for people in regulated industries. They focus on compliance and data security.

Skuad: Best for Emerging Market Expansion

Skuad provides great value with its competitive prices. It operates in over 160 countries, including many emerging markets. Its unified platform makes global expansion easier. It handles compliant onboarding, multi-currency payroll, and benefits management. Skuad gets a lot of praise for its quick customer support and strong regional knowledge.

This helps businesses deal with the unique labor laws and cultural differences in Asia, Africa, and Latin America. Skuad offers a great and affordable solution for businesses wanting to grow their teams in these fast-growing areas.

Oyster HR: Best for Mission-Driven Companies

Oyster HR is designed for companies that are building a truly distributed, global-first culture. Its platform offers more than just EOR services. It provides tools for hiring talent and local benefits packages. It also helps boost employee engagement across various time zones. Oyster HR wants to make global employment easier for everyone.

They offer clear pricing and a user-friendly interface. Its mission-driven approach attracts businesses that want a fully remote, connected global team. It’s a strong partner for organizations aiming for a positive and fair global employee experience.

Rippling: Best for Unifying HR and IT

Rippling offers a unique solution. It combines its EOR services with a complete workforce management platform. This platform brings together HR, IT, and finance. This allows businesses to manage payroll and benefits. They can also handle employee apps, devices, and permissions from a single source.

This system is great for automating onboarding and offboarding. You can add a new hire to payroll, enroll them in benefits, and set up work applications all in one easy step. Companies looking for more than an EOR should consider Rippling. It streamlines the entire employee lifecycle with strong automation features.

Step 1: Define Your Global Hiring Needs

The first step is to create a detailed map of your requirements. Which specific countries are you hiring in, both now and in the near future? The provider’s strength and entity status in these key locations is paramount.

Identify your workforce type: Will you hire full-time employees, independent contractors, or a mix of both?

Set a clear budget. Think about the monthly management fee and the total employment cost. This includes statutory contributions and benefits.

Step 2: Compare Pricing Models and Hidden Costs

EOR pricing can vary significantly, so it is crucial to understand the details. Compare flat-fee monthly pricing to models that charge a percentage of the employee’s salary. Then, calculate which option is cheaper for your hiring plans. Check for any extra charges.

These can include onboarding fees, offboarding fees, FX markups, or costs for off-cycle payments. A clear pricing structure that grows with your company is key to long-term financial planning.

Step 3: Evaluate Customer Support and Expertise

The quality of support can make or break the EOR experience. Check if the provider gives you a dedicated account manager or if support is through a general ticketing system. Make sure they have local HR and legal experts in your target countries.

These experts can offer reliable advice on complex employment issues. Reading recent customer reviews and case studies gives useful insights. They show how responsive a provider is and the quality of their support.

  • 4. How do I switch from one EOR provider to another?

    Switching EOR providers requires careful coordination. To keep the employee's job, end the current contract with the EOR. Then, sign a new contract with the new provider. Re-hiring needs careful management. You must address final pay, benefit transitions, and compliance. It's best to seek expert guidance for this process.

  • 5. Do all EOR companies offer the same services?

    No. All EOR companies offer basic services like compliant hiring, payroll, and benefits. However, their approaches vary greatly.

    Differences include:

    • Global coverage
    • Ownership of local entities or use of partners
    • Level of customer support
    • Technology platform offered
    • Additional services like integrated HRIS or IT management
